The 151st Preakness Stakes will take place on Saturday, but it will not take place at its usual track.
For the first time ever, the Preakness Stakes will be held on a different course than Pimlico Race Course. The circuit, located in Baltimore, is under construction and it is hoped that it will be ready next season.
This year’s Preakness Stakes will be held at Laurel Park, just outside Washington, D.C., and about 20 miles south of Pimlico Race Course.

The Preakness Stakes will also take place without Kentucky Derby winner Golden Tempo, meaning there will be no chance of witnessing a potential Triple Crown this year.
Fourteen 3-year-old horses will travel 1 3/16 miles, competing for a $2 million purse.

What everyone is talking about before the Preakness Stakes
The weekend got off to a tragic start as on Friday, Hit Zero collapsed and died after crossing the finish line in his first career race.
Hit Zero, who was trained by Russell, came in last place after being the favorite to win. After crossing the finish line, Hit Zero started coughing, got on his knees, lowered his head and died.
Horse racing fans are hoping to avoid further drama during the second leg of the Triple Crown.
Fourteen horses are in the race, which represents the most the race has seen in 15 years. This is the second time in the last 40 years that the first or second in the Kentucky Derby has not competed in the Preakness Stakes.

Only three of the Preakness Stakes horses competed in the Kentucky Derby: Ocelli (finished third), Robusta (finished 14th), and Incredibolt (finished sixth). Great White was scheduled to run in the Kentucky Derby but was scratched.
Hot on the heels of Cherie DeVaux becoming the first trainer to see her horse win the Kentucky Derby, Russell is looking to become the first trainer to win the Preakness Stakes.
Taj Mahal, Russell’s horse, won all three races he entered at Laurel.
